Skip to content

Commit 90f55dc

Browse files
committed
use 127.0.0.1 to avoid zookeeper picking up an ipv6 address
1 parent f5aba65 commit 90f55dc

File tree

2 files changed

+8
-7
lines changed

2 files changed

+8
-7
lines changed

external/kafka-0-10-sql/src/test/scala/org/apache/spark/sql/kafka010/KafkaTestUtils.scala

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-56,7 +56,7 @@ import org.apache.spark.util.Utils
5656
class KafkaTestUtils(withBrokerProps: Map[String, Object] = Map.empty) extends Logging {
5757

5858
// Zookeeper related configurations
59-
private val zkHost = "localhost"
59+
private val zkHost = "127.0.0.1"
6060
private var zkPort: Int = 0
6161
private val zkConnectionTimeout = 60000
6262
private val zkSessionTimeout = 6000
@@ -67,7 +67,7 @@ class KafkaTestUtils(withBrokerProps: Map[String, Object] = Map.empty) extends L
6767
private var adminClient: AdminClient = null
6868

6969
// Kafka broker related configurations
70-
private val brokerHost = "localhost"
70+
private val brokerHost = "127.0.0.1"
7171
private var brokerPort = 0
7272
private var brokerConf: KafkaConfig = _
7373

@@ -299,8 +299,8 @@ class KafkaTestUtils(withBrokerProps: Map[String, Object] = Map.empty) extends L
299299
protected def brokerConfiguration: Properties = {
300300
val props = new Properties()
301301
props.put("broker.id", "0")
302-
props.put("host.name", "localhost")
303-
props.put("advertised.host.name", "localhost")
302+
props.put("host.name", "127.0.0.1")
303+
props.put("advertised.host.name", "127.0.0.1")
304304
props.put("port", brokerPort.toString)
305305
props.put("log.dir", Utils.createTempDir().getAbsolutePath)
306306
props.put("zookeeper.connect", zkAddress)

external/kafka-0-10/src/test/scala/org/apache/spark/streaming/kafka010/KafkaTestUtils.scala

Lines changed: 4 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-50,7 +50,7 @@ import org.apache.spark.util.Utils
5050
private[kafka010] class KafkaTestUtils extends Logging {
5151

5252
// Zookeeper related configurations
53-
private val zkHost = "localhost"
53+
private val zkHost = "127.0.0.1"
5454
private var zkPort: Int = 0
5555
private val zkConnectionTimeout = 60000
5656
private val zkSessionTimeout = 6000
@@ -60,7 +60,7 @@ private[kafka010] class KafkaTestUtils extends Logging {
6060
private var zkUtils: ZkUtils = _
6161

6262
// Kafka broker related configurations
63-
private val brokerHost = "localhost"
63+
private val brokerHost = "127.0.0.1"
6464
private var brokerPort = 0
6565
private var brokerConf: KafkaConfig = _
6666

@@ -217,7 +217,8 @@ private[kafka010] class KafkaTestUtils extends Logging {
217217
private def brokerConfiguration: Properties = {
218218
val props = new Properties()
219219
props.put("broker.id", "0")
220-
props.put("host.name", "localhost")
220+
props.put("host.name", "127.0.0.1")
221+
props.put("advertised.host.name", "127.0.0.1")
221222
props.put("port", brokerPort.toString)
222223
props.put("log.dir", brokerLogDir)
223224
props.put("zookeeper.connect", zkAddress)

0 commit comments

Comments
 (0)